McCain Foods to close Wisconsin plant

McCain Foods is closing its processing plant in Fort Atkinson.  The plant employs 130 people, closure should be completed by the end of December.  Production will be moved to McCain’s Rice Lake facility.  The company also has plants in Plover and Appleton, Wisconsin.

Headquartered in Canada, McCain employs over 20,000 people in 57 plants on six continents.  With annual sales of over 6 billion (Canadian), McCain is the world’s largest producer of french fries and potato specialties with products in more than 130 countries.
